GCC CONTEXT
Tkatuf, Oman's recurring small and medium-sized enterprise (SME) exhibition series, reflects the GCC's broader policy focus on economic diversification away from hydrocarbon dependence and the development of non-oil sectors. SME-focused events across the Gulf historically correlate with periods of structural economic reform, regional financing initiatives, and shifts in government procurement and supply-chain localization strategies. Such exhibitions typically generate data on entrepreneurial activity, regional business sentiment, and the effectiveness of Omani and broader GCC support mechanisms for private-sector growth—metrics closely monitored by Gulf policymakers and market participants tracking economic resilience and labor market dynamics.
